Earthquake occurs in Mugu



MUGU: An earthquake of 4.5 magnitude occurred at 9:15 this morning with its epicenter in Mugu district, the National Earthquake Monitoring and Research Centre, Lainchaur, said.

The earthquake was felt in the districts of Karnali and Sudurpaschim provinces.

The eastern and western regions of the country have recorded more earthquakes in the recent time.
